Amazing location, facilities and staff, shame about clique surf scene
This hostel, the front desk posse, the setting, beach access, and cleanliness will blow your mind. If youre a surfer, the clique scene that extends from the frosty atmosphered bar to the group surfs will not. Not only does it clog the breaks a bit like rush hour at the preferred Point but also serves to exclude surfers who either haven't been living at the hostel for fourteen months or who don't show up with the mandatory dreads, cheap leather necklace, and flimsy traveling philosophy. All in all, an impressive hostel that just needs to figure out if it's a fun place to be or a second home for drop outs who think they deserved a place on the pro-tour.

Lovely! We stayed in a double en-suite room in the beachhouse and it was the best views that we've ever had, you almost feel like sleeping on the beach. The bar offers a big variety of different foods including a big selection for breakfast. The hostel is surfer's paradise, so we kind of stuck out but this didn't make us feel uncomfortable or unwelcome. Credit cards are accepted and discount for students is available. Although not located in a safe area the hostel's security is very good so that there's no need to worry. And nothing beats a morning walk on the beach.
